I've just upgraded my monitor to a rather nice 23" wide screen panel. It gives an amazing 1920x1200 resolution which is great for map work. Apart from mapping apps' nothing needs to be maximised.
One problem (or rather annoyance) that I have spotted with Pro (v6.5) is that the when using Node Reshape, the node blocks are rather chunky - they are 11 pixels square. I'm sure this is not a fixed size and perhaps has been calculated as a division of the total screen width. Unless I've missed it, I assume there is no way of changing this (the logical place to look was in the dialog which contains the highlight styles). Has anyone else seen this with wide screens, or maybe duel displays?
